Job Description - Product Specialist / Pavement and Transportation

The Product Specialist / Pavement & Transportation supports GSSI customers and internal teams through deep technical knowledge of pavement evaluation, transportation infrastructure applications, and GSSI’s specialized product portfolio. This role provides advanced technical support, creates application specific training programs, conducts in-field engagements, and contributes critical application feedback to enhance our Pavement and Transportation roadmaps.


 


Key Responsibilities: 



  • Collaboratively provide Tier 2/3 product support and troubleshooting for GSSI hardware and software, with an emphasis on GSSI’s pavement and transportation products

  • Conduct and lead customer training, onboarding, and field implementation of GSSI products

  • Contribute to application notes, technical guides, FAQs, and internal knowledge bases 

  • Collaborate with sales for technical demos, pre-sales support, and post-sale follow-up 

  • Capture and communicate customer feedback to Product Management for roadmap consideration 

  • Participate in product testing, validation, and support readiness for new releases 

  • Assist at trade shows, webinars, and events as a technical representative 

  • Along with peers, create, maintain, and update online LMS training content to help customers achieve success with GSSI products.



Education, Skills & Qualifications: 



  • Bachelor’s degree in a technical field preferred; instructional experience or certification a plus.

  • 3+ years in a technical support, applications, or product-focused role (GPR or field instrumentation experience a plus) 

  • Strong technical and problem-solving skills with the ability to communicate clearly across audiences 

  • Experience with pavement process control, including in the lab or in the field is highly desired


 


Travel Requirements: 


This position will require 25% - 50% travel.  Some international travel may be required. 


 


Physical Demands: 


The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. 



While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k hear, and use fine motor skills. The employee is frequently required to stand, walk, sit, and reach. The employee is occasionally required to bend, kneel, squat, climb, and lift. The employee must occasionally lift or carry a maximum of 90 lbs.  Finally, the employee is frequently required to drive an automobile.
